Output 51c8d318549b00e7505897fcb53861808f9b05bfb6fd46a2c0d4462839b97ca1:0

value
4000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9518a7609b21ee453e7a0350e2e2fcff19778807 OP_EQUALVERIFY OP_CHECKSIG
address
1EbMDZUvubaZtN711S2o4VqLNh7YN2RfF7
transaction
51c8d318549b00e7505897fcb53861808f9b05bfb6fd46a2c0d4462839b97ca1
spent
true